Company Overview:
Blue Sky Farm is a third generation family farm located in the heart of the Willamette Valley near Woodburn, Oregon. Over the years we have diversified into a variety of crops, however the back bone of the operation is producing turf type grass seed. Along with the three major types of grass seed; ryegrass, tall fescue and bent grass we also produce hops, hazelnuts, garlic, pumpkins, wheat, clover, corn, and specialty vegetable seeds such as spinach, radish, mustard and cabbage. Every summer we hire local help to operate harvest equipment and have a great tradition of providing summer jobs to hardworking first time employees.
